Chicomba is a municipality located in the Huambo Province of Angola, situated at the coordinates -14.13333, 14.91667. It lies in the central part of the country, making it a significant point within the region’s geography. The city operates within the Africa/Luanda timezone, which aligns with the capital city and much of the coastal regions of Angola.
Chicomba is primarily known for its agricultural activities, with the local economy relying heavily on farming. The area is characterized by its rural landscape and the cultivation of various crops. Additionally, Chicomba serves as a vital hub for surrounding communities, facilitating trade and access to goods and services within Huambo Province.
Timezone in Chicomba
Chicomba is located in Angola and operates on West Africa Time, specifically in the Africa/Luanda timezone, with a UTC offset of +1. This region does not observe daylight saving time, meaning that the time remains consistent throughout the year. As a result, there are no seasonal changes to account for when scheduling communications or travel plans.

Practical Information for Visitors
Chicomba is located in the Huambo Province of Angola, making it accessible primarily by road. The nearest airport is in Huambo city, approximately 30 kilometers away. From Huambo, travelers can take a bus or hire a taxi to reach Chicomba.
Public transport options in the region may be limited, so arranging private transport in advance is advisable. Chicomba experiences a tropical climate, with a rainy season from October to April and a dry season from May to September. The best time to visit is during the dry season when temperatures are more moderate and outdoor activities are more enjoyable.
